Abstract

The invention provides a traditional Chinese medicine composition for treating ancylostomiasis. The traditional Chinese medicine composition comprises grand torreya seed, sargentgloryvine stem, stemona root, betel nut seed, melia root bark, realgar and garlic, is capable of expelling parasites, mainly treats ancylostomiasis and has a clinical effective rate of 93%.

Technical field
Treat a combination of Chinese medicine for intestinal tract disease, particularly one and treat uncinariatic combination of Chinese medicine.
Background technology
Ancylostomiasis is many to be caused by the skin infection hook larva of a tapeworm or the cercaria of a schistosome, and the hook larva of a tapeworm or the cercaria of a schistosome, via microcirculation or lymphatic vessel, enters bronchioles with blood flow, then through the pharyngeal gastral cavity that enters, settles down and in small intestinal, develop into ancylostome adult.Existing medicine adopts chemotherapy, has certain toxic and side effects.
Summary of the invention
The invention provides the uncinariatic combination of Chinese medicine of a kind of eutherapeutic treatment, overcome existing medical weak point.
One is treated uncinariatic combination of Chinese medicine, can be made into water preparation, pill, and composition percentage by weight is:
Semen Torreyae 25%, Caulis Sargentodoxae 25%, the Radix Stemonae 15%, betel nut 10%, Cortex Meliae 10%, Realgar 10%, Bulbus Allii 10%.
Present composition Chinese medicine has insect-expelling function, cures mainly ancylostomiasis, clinical effective rate 93%.
Detailed description of the invention
Embodiment 1, one are treated uncinariatic combination of Chinese medicine, and composition percentage by weight is:
Semen Torreyae 25%, Caulis Sargentodoxae 25%, the Radix Stemonae 15%, betel nut 10%, Cortex Meliae 10%, Realgar 10%, Bulbus Allii 10%.
Be decocted in water for oral dose, every day potion, serveing on seven doses can fully recover.
